Rajasthan Royals IPL 2026: Youth, Potential & Challenges

Rajasthan Royals fans might experience a sense of déjà vu as the IPL 2026 season approaches. The team is built around a proven, star spin bowler and a collection of relatively young and inexpensive players – a formula reminiscent of their successful 2008 campaign. This combination highlights both the team’s potential strengths and vulnerabilities as they head into the tournament.

The Royals’ biggest asset is undoubtedly their youthful core. The team is built around a strong base of Indian talent, led by captain Riyan Parag, and featuring promising players like Yashasvi Jaiswal, Dhruv Jurel, and Ravi Bishnoi. Their confidence and aggressive approach to the game make Rajasthan a dangerous opponent. The presence of Ravindra Jadeja adds stability and tactical direction to this young squad. This balance of youth and experience is a key strength for the Royals.

However, that same youth could also prove to be a weakness. It remains to be seen if they can maintain composure in high-pressure matches. The relative inexperience of Parag as a captain is also a factor. The bowling inconsistencies that plagued them last season haven’t necessarily been resolved.

The opportunities ahead are significant. If this youth-focused model proves successful, Rajasthan could establish a new blueprint for team building in the IPL. They have the potential to build a consistent core and dominate for multiple seasons. Guidance from a senior player like Sangakkara could accelerate the development of these young talents.

But the challenges are equally substantial. In a competitive league like the IPL, youthful enthusiasm alone isn’t enough; maturity is crucial. Opponents will likely target the Royals’ bowling attack. A dip in form from one or two key players could also disrupt the team’s balance. A successful season for Rajasthan would be a revolutionary story; a failure would serve as a reminder of the importance of experience.
